当前位置:文档之家› 通过注册表建立Network Adress

通过注册表建立Network Adress

通过注册表建立Network Adress
我现在遇到了个很棘手的问题有个人连接到路由器上和我一起上网…而且他很不自觉他要是自己浏览网页聊天我也就不管了…但是他24小时用电驴下载电脑下载电影搞的我网速狂慢!!!我本来想利用访问控制禁止他的MAC 地址结果我不小心紧了他和我的地址都连不上了!!!……很急
我在网上说可以在网卡的属性…高级里改有个叫NETWORK ADDRESS但是我没有他们说有的网卡没有但是可以在注册表里建不是专业的人不会啊所以…
我当时是设置的只允许连接此地址的设备以外的连接都不给…我把我的地址(也不确定是不是我的电脑的地址反正是每次连上后在连接列表显示的地址输了上去)和他的地址输了上去结果我现在根本就连不上去
下面我要说怎么查看自己正确的MAC地址
1. 点击开始菜单
2. 选择“运行”
3. 在运行框上输入CMD 并回车
4. 在命令提示符窗口的C:>
输入IPCONFIG/ALL
5. 记录下其中的Physiacl Address……:
例如:33-30-13-2A-62-6B
那个就是你正确的MAC地址了……如果你看到的不一样说不定那是你网卡的MAC地址并不是你电脑的MAC地址!!我就是错在这里!!把网卡的MAC地址弄了上去结果我还是上不上去下面就是一般人很头疼的问题!!通过注册表建立Network Adress首先在“开始”--》“运行”输入:regedit 进入注册表编辑器。

1、在hkey_local_machinesystemcurrentcontrolsetcontrolclass{4d36e972-e325-11ce-bfc1-08002be10318}000、0001、0002等主键下,查找driverdesc内容为你要修改的网卡的描述的,如0000。

2在其下,添加一个字符串,命名为NetworkAddress ,其值设为你要的MAC 地址(注意地址还是连续写)。

如:999999999999 。

3 、然后到其下Ndiparams 中添加一项名为NetworkAddress 的主键,在该主键下添加名为default的字符串,其值是你要设的MAC 地址,要连续写,如:000000000000 。

(实际上这只是设置在后面提到的高级属性中的“初始值”,实际使用的MAC地址还是取决于在第 2 点中提到的NetworkAddress 参数,这个参数一旦设置后,以后高级属性中的值就是NetworkAddress 给出的值而非default 给出的了。


4 、在NetworkAddress 的主键下继续添加名为ParamDesc 的字符串,其作用为指定NetworkAddress 主键
的描述,其值可自己命名,如“ Network Address ”,这样在网卡的高级属性中就会出现Network Address 选项,就是你刚在注册表中加的新项NetworkAddress ,以后只要在此修改MAC 地址就可以了。

继续添加名为Optional 的字符串,其值设为“ 1 ”,则以后当你在网卡的高级属性中选择Network Address 项时,右边会出现“不存在”选项。

5、重新启动你的计算机,打开网络邻居的属性,双击相应网卡项会发现有一个Network Address高级设置项,可以用来直接修改MAC 地址或恢复原来的地址基于上述方法可能导致别人盗用你的mac地址,从而局域网的DNS服务器在分配IP时会给两台电脑分配同样的IP。

因此,为避免造成经济损失,还是对自己的mac地址做好保密工作吧。

一切~大公告成!。

相关主题